NAME

       plbox - Draw a box with axes, etc

SYNOPSIS

       plbox(xopt, xtick, nxsub, yopt, ytick, nysub)

DESCRIPTION

       Draws  a  box  around  the currently defined viewport, and labels it with world coordinate
       values appropriate to the  window.   Thus  plbox(3plplot)  should  only  be  called  after
       defining  both viewport and window.  The ascii character strings xopt and yopt specify how
       the box should be drawn as described below.  If ticks and/or subticks are to be drawn  for
       a  particular  axis,  the  tick  intervals  and  number  of  subintervals may be specified
       explicitly, or they may be defaulted by setting the appropriate arguments to zero.

       Redacted form: General: plbox(xopt, xtick, nxsub, yopt, ytick, nysub)

       This function is used in examples 1, 2, 4, 6, 6-12, 14-18, 21, 23-26, and 29.

ARGUMENTS

       xopt (PLCHAR_VECTOR(3plplot), input)
              An ascii character string specifying options  for  the  x  axis.   The  string  can
              include  any  combination  of  the  following  letters (upper or lower case) in any
              order: a: Draws axis, X-axis is horizontal line (y=0), and Y-axis is vertical  line
              (x=0).   b:  Draws bottom (X) or left (Y) edge of frame.  c: Draws top (X) or right
              (Y) edge of frame.  d: Plot labels as date / time. Values are assumed to be seconds
              since  the  epoch  (as used by gmtime).  f:  Always use fixed point numeric labels.
              g: Draws a grid at the major tick interval.  h: Draws a  grid  at  the  minor  tick
              interval.   i: Inverts tick marks, so they are drawn outwards, rather than inwards.
              l: Labels axis logarithmically.  This only affects the labels, not the data, and so
              it is necessary to compute the logarithms of data points before passing them to any
              of the drawing routines.  m: Writes numeric labels at major tick intervals  in  the
              unconventional  location  (above box for X, right of box for Y).  n: Writes numeric
              labels at major tick intervals in the conventional location (below box for X,  left
              of  box for Y).  o: Use custom labelling function to generate axis label text.  The
              custom labelling function can be defined with  the  plslabelfunc(3plplot)  command.
              s:  Enables  subticks  between  major ticks, only valid if t is also specified.  t:
              Draws major ticks.  u: Exactly like "b" except don't draw edge  line.   w:  Exactly
              like  "c"  except  don't  draw  edge line.  x: Exactly like "t" (including the side
              effect of the numerical labels for the major  ticks)  except  exclude  drawing  the
              major and minor tick marks.

       xtick (PLFLT(3plplot), input)
              World  coordinate interval between major ticks on the x axis. If it is set to zero,
              PLplot automatically generates a suitable tick interval.

       nxsub (PLINT(3plplot), input)
              Number of subintervals between major x axis ticks for minor ticks.  If it is set to
              zero, PLplot automatically generates a suitable minor tick interval.

       yopt (PLCHAR_VECTOR(3plplot), input)
              An  ascii  character  string  specifying  options  for  the y axis.  The string can
              include any combination of the letters defined above for xopt, and in addition  may
              contain:  v: Write numeric labels for the y axis parallel to the base of the graph,
              rather than parallel to the axis.

       ytick (PLFLT(3plplot), input)
              World coordinate interval between major ticks on the y axis. If it is set to  zero,
              PLplot automatically generates a suitable tick interval.

       nysub (PLINT(3plplot), input)
              Number of subintervals between major y axis ticks for minor ticks.  If it is set to
              zero, PLplot automatically generates a suitable minor tick interval.
